>I get a syntax error when running /bin/bash ./ok.
>: No such file or catalog
>/ok: Checking: command not found
      ^^^^^^^^
>#!/bin/bash
>/*
>Checking cached mail
 ^^^^^^^^
You are using the C syntax for comments. This is not what bash
expects: use instead # to comment till end of line.
